In the tradition of Marshall McLuhan, Thomas Langan provides a very provocative and reflective analysis of how fast- paced technological developments are shaping the world and our consciousness. Lamb Author InformationThomas Langan is Professor Emeritus of Philosophy at the University of Toronto. He is the author of numerous books, including The Catholic Tradition, and Tradition and Authenticity in the Search for Ecumenic Wisdom. Tab Content 6Author Website:Countries AvailableAll regions |
